Week in Review

What a week!! It’s definitely been a busy one.

  • We’ve seen the McBride saga come to a close with TFC being the recipient of a 1st round draft pick, allocation money and one Chad Barrett (I’ve already eaten my words with my Lets all laugh at Chicago post).  All in all I’d say its a good deal though.  Barrett may miss the broad side of a barn from time to time but he’s still got more goals than most of TFC (tied with Dichio with 5)
  • Tebily is gone, long live Tebily.  So much for wanting him back
  • The MLS are 5-0 against international competition.  Whoop dee woo!  Although I should give props to DeRo for scoring the game winner.  Him and Jimmy B make a good combo *fingers crossed*
  • Edu and Wynne are gone for the time being.  Best of luck to them at the Olympics, I won’t be upset with a quick USA exit though.

  • And finally it looks like MLS has lost a great talent to Europe, again. Kenny Cooper has been picked up by Cardiff City for a reported $4 million transfer fee.  It’s truly a shame that MLS cannot and will not compete on an international basis until (hopefully) the next CBA
